This brand new handset by HTC is identified as the Htc desire handset is the in-house version of the Google Nexus One meaning what we should get is a magnificent smartphone running the newest version of the Google Android os (v2.1 or clair for all those still keeping count). As well as to the updated Operating system, the Desire, which was up to now known as the HTC Bravo will furthermore will offer HTCs individual Sense interface which get its messages from Facebook and Twitter, updates your pals status in the contacts list, lets you upload photos to Flickr and offers 7 customisable home screens. Add shortcuts, live web feeds and much more to one of the home screens and flick between these or pinch on the screen to see all 7 screens shot at once if that is what you want to do.
Running the unit is a One GHz Snapdragon processor which guarantees moving in between homescreens, launching apps and opening website pages is really smooth not to mention a great looking on the stunning 3.7 inc AMOLED touchscreen technology. It's capacitive technological innovation permits multi-touch which makes it possible for such attributes as pinch to zoom from the web browser and maps plus makes for one of the fluid, responsive touchscreens that bloggers have observed in a mobile. AMOLED technology produces one of the best displays being offered whilst as well saving battery life and space permitting the unit to measure just 11.9 mm deep.
This particular mobile offers a 5 mega pixel camera, HSDPA and Wi-Fi connectivity, GPS and expandable memory up to 32GB and its easy to understand why the HTC Desire is surely an first contender for being the best phone of the year. The Nokia N8 will be the latest smartphone to be made available by Nokia and would be the first ever mobile phone to be created with the Symbian 3 platform. The digital camera looks to be as good as we hoped, with a xenon flash backing up the 12 megapixel Carl Zeiss lens, along with the chance to capture video at 720p.
The 3.5 inch resistive touch screen has a nHD resolution of 360 x 640 pixels for incredible picture quality and the ability to display as much as 16 million colours. The brilliant screen can make web browsing with 3G HSDPA a pleasure and with GPRS/EDGE and Wi-Fi will enable users to jump online at breakneck speed and with little work.
The Nokia N8 phone also doubles as a mobile and portable entertainment center. It'll offer users the ability to watch TV on the web including content from CNN and local Web TV content this implies we in the UK will be able to watch BBC iPlayer. Its not simply the twelve mp camera and Hd video capabilities using HDMI support which sets the Nokia N8 apart from the crowd. Packaging more memory than most, the Nokia N8 mobile phone has 16GB of built in storage room and is expandable approximately 48gb by using a micro SDcard.
All of the usual social networking functions are present and correct though, with a single application allowing status updates and the viewing of live feeds, plus a calendar syncing tool also. On the media side, the Nokia N8 mobile phone will give you access to local and global Internet TV services directly from the homescreen.
Nokia is putting out its first phone featuring the revamped Symbian 3 OS, which includes several new features, such as multi-touch, flick scrolling, and pinch-to-zoom. Symbian 3 adds several other features found on competing smartphone platforms, like multiple home screens and home screen widgets (similar to Android) for Facebook and Twitter, among others.
Naturally, the Nokia N8 mobile phone includes gaining access to the entire range of Ovi services and it is Nokias very first smartphone to be bundled with Qt. Got a concept for a application? Qt is a new software development environment that means it is a cinch to build applications and release them throughout the Symbian along with other software platforms.
